BRANFORD, CT — The 2024 Branford Fire Department awards ceremony is the annual event where Branford first responders are honored for their service to the community. As noted, the fire department provides the "highest level of service to our community by valuing our members, promoting positive leadership, and dedicating ourselves to excellence."

Held Monday at The Woodwinds, Branford Fire Department Chief Thomas F. Mahoney Jr., elected officials, the Board of Fire Commissioners, and dignitaries gather to present awards to professional and volunteers firefighters. Retired Branford Deputy Chief and Director of CT Division of Emergency Management and Homeland Security William J. Hackett is the keynote speaker.
